안녕하세요! 오늘은 React와 shadcn/ui를 사용하여 완전한 기능을 갖춘 공학용 계산기를 만들어보겠습니다. 이 튜토리얼을 통해 React의 상태 관리, 이벤트 처리, 그리고 UI 컴포넌트 구성 방법을 배울 수 있습니다.프로젝트 설정먼저 필요한 의존성을 설치합니다:# shadcn/ui 컴포넌트 설치npx create-next-app@latest my-calculator --typescript --tailwind --eslintcd my-calculatornpx shadcn-ui@latest init컴포넌트 구조우리의 계산기는 단일 React 컴포넌트로 구현됩니다. 주요 기능은 다음과 같습니다:기본 산술 연산 (덧셈, 뺄셈, 곱셈, 나눗셈)공학 계산 기능 (삼각함수, 로그, 제곱근)상수 값 (π, e..